Description of Role:The Maintenance Technician is responsible for maintaining and repairing equipment in a fast-paced, high-production environment while effectively prioritizing multiple mechanical, electrical, and administrative tasks. Key responsibilities include troubleshooting and servicing advanced pneumatic systems, basic hydraulic systems, AC/DC electrical systems, automation (PLC and instrumentation), machining, and mechanical systems across all process and packaging equipment.

- Perform routine electrical and mechanical problem- solving process and packaging equipment.
- Troubleshoot, repair, and overhaul equipment with precision, maintaining close tolerances.
- Conduct Preventative Maintenance (PM) and Predictive Maintenance ( PdM ) on process and packaging equipment
- Support Operations with equipment setup, changeovers, and training operators in Autonomous Maintenance (AM) activities.
- Accurately document Work Orders (WO) using the Computerized Maintenance Management System (SAP-PPM Plant Maintenance).
- Actively engage in Total Productive Maintenance (TPM) principles by participating in Pillar Teams and training fellow Technicians and Operators in AM activities, including conducting Breakdown Analysis (BDA).
- Comply with Lock-Out/Tag-Out (LOTO) procedures, Confined Space protocols, and all Plant Safety and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P) to ensure machinery uptime and workplace safety.
